xen: credit2: issues in csched2_cpu_pick(), when tracing is enabled.
In fact, when not finding a suitable runqueue where to
place a vCPU, and hence using a fallback, we either:
- don't issue any trace record (while we should, at
least, output the chosen pcpu),
- risk underruning when accessing the runqueues
array, while preparing the trace record.
Fix both issues and, while there, also a couple of style
problems found nearby.
Spotted by Coverity.
